Concession fares are restricted to students in uniform, people above 60 years of age and the<br />

disabled. These are made available through a form-based application process. RapidKL also issues<br />

multiple journey passes for various types of individual or combined services for bus and rail which<br />

are available 1, 3, 7, 15 or 30 day passes.<br />

Individual consultations with the larger operators revealed a range of fares related concerns:<br />

<br />

<br />

<br />

Fares not being set at a sufficient level to generate investment back into the organisation<br />

to enable key requirements such as fleet investment, improved staff training or to maintain<br />

operator viability<br />

Regular fare evasion occurring and the lack of proper penalties being enforced, which<br />

results in the inability for the operators to recoup costs and reinvest in services<br />

Increased „over-riding‟ through zones and the lack of enforcement to counter this<br />
